CPOE (Computerized Physician Order Entry)

Clin

ical

8 - A & B

Is it merely the electronic entry of instructions and orders communicated electronically to pharmacies, labs and radiology or is there more to CPOE? Beginning in 2013, CMS added an optional alternate measure to the Meaningful Use objective for CPOE and all providers will be required to accomplish this in Stage 2. This session explores all that you need to know about CPOE.

Getting PCMH Recognition

Clin

ical

8 - A, B, & C

The patient-centered medical home is one of the most important and modern innovations in modern healthcare. It emphasizes care coordination and communication to transform primary care into “what patients want it to be.” According to the NCQA Patient-Centered Medical Home, (PCMH) Recognition is the most widely-adopted model for transforming primary care practices into medical homes. This session will focus on the requirements of the PCMH Recognition.

Introduction to ACO(s)11:15 - 12:00 pm

Hea

lthca

re R

efor

m

Auditorium8th Floor

ACO(s) are a network of health care providers that work together to provide care for certain individuals by coordinating to improve the quality and reduce costs in order to “share” savings. This session will explore the ACO model and how this a�ects your practice and primary care providers across the nation.

Health Insurance Exchange

Fina

ncia

l

Meeting Room 12nd Floor

The ObamaCare Health Insurance Exchange (HIX) opened on October 1st. These exchanges are online marketplaces for health insurance. Americans can use their State's "A�ordable" Insurance Exchange marketplace to get coverage from competing private health care providers. This session will take an in-depth look at HIX and how it a�ects your practice.
